The prestigious Certificate for Sustainable Tourism is a program created by the Costa Rican Tourism Board to categorize and differentiate tourism companies according to the degree to which their operations approach a model of sustainability in the management of natural, cultural and social resources. For more information on this certificate, you can visit the official website www.turismo-sostenible.co.cr
The program awards business with one to five leaves.
GWA has been awarded with 4 leaves and we are working hard to get our fifth leave, the highest certification of the program.
